Best Time to Visit Sikkim from Mumbai
Sikkim is a year-round destination, but choosing the right season enhances the experience. Here’s a seasonal guide:
Summer (March to June) – Ideal for sightseeing, adventure sports, and exploring monasteries.
Monsoon (July to September) – Not recommended due to landslides and heavy rains.
Autumn (October to November) – Perfect for nature lovers, as the valleys come alive with vibrant hues.
Winter (December to February) – Best for snow lovers, with mesmerizing views of the snow-capped peaks.
How to Reach Sikkim from Mumbai?
By Air: The nearest airport to Sikkim is Bagdogra Airport (IXB) in West Bengal, approximately 124 km from Gangtok.
Direct and connecting flights are available from Mumbai to Bagdogra.
From Bagdogra, a scenic 4-5 hour drive via private cab or shared taxis leads to Sikkim.
By Train: The nearest railway station is New Jalpaiguri (NJP), around 120 km from Gangtok.
Several long-distance trains operate between Mumbai and NJP, followed by a road journey to Sikkim.
By Road: Private taxis and state-run buses connect NJP and Bagdogra to Sikkim.
The road journey is an adventure in itself, with picturesque landscapes and gushing rivers along the way.
Top Places to Visit in Sikkim
Gangtok – The Capital City
Gangtok is a vibrant city offering breathtaking views of Mount Kanchenjunga. Major attractions include:
MG Marg – A pedestrian-only shopping street.
Tsomgo Lake – A mesmerizing glacial lake.
Nathula Pass – A high-altitude mountain pass on the Indo-China border.
Rumtek Monastery – One of the largest and most significant monasteries in Sikkim.
Pelling – The Scenic Retreat
Pelling is known for its stunning views of the Himalayas and the following attractions:
Pemayangtse Monastery – A 17th-century monastery offering spiritual bliss.
Rimbi and Kanchenjunga Waterfalls – Nature’s marvels.
Skywalk Pelling – India’s first glass skywalk with a spectacular view.
Lachung, Lachen & Yumthang Valley – The Snow Paradise
For those craving an escape into pristine snow-covered landscapes, visit:
Lachung – A charming mountain village.
Gurudongmar Lake – One of the highest lakes in the world.
Yumthang Valley – The ‘Valley of Flowers of Sikkim’.
Zuluk – The Offbeat Destination
Adventure seekers must explore Zuluk, known for its famous zigzag roads and panoramic mountain views.
Exciting Activities to Do in Sikkim
Paragliding in Gangtok – Soar above the clouds.
Yak Ride at Tsomgo Lake – A unique experience.
River Rafting in Teesta River – An adrenaline-pumping adventure.
Trekking in Goechala – A paradise for trekkers.
Hot Spring Therapy in Yumthang – Natural healing experience.

Tips for a Hassle-Free Sikkim Tour from Mumbai
✅ Carry valid government IDs for permits.
✅ Pack warm clothes, especially for high-altitude regions.
✅ Keep cash handy, as ATMs are limited in remote areas.
✅ Book accommodations and transport in advance during peak seasons.
✅ Respect local culture and traditions while visiting monasteries.
